Responsibilities

Lead day-to-day planning, scheduling, and execution of all environmental testing, including vibration (random, sine, sine-on-random, gunfire), thermal cycling, thermal shock, humidity, and vibe-under-temperature testing
Interpret and execute test procedures, MIL-STD and DO-160 requirements, and internal specifications to ensure full environmental compliance
Set up and operate environmental test systems including 3-axis shakers, thermal chambers, humidity chambers, and thermal shock equipment
Build and run thermal and vibration profiles; collaborate with engineers to design and review vibration fixtures and mounting hardware
Process, review, and analyze vibration and thermal data using Excel, PDF reporting, and internal systems
Diagnose and troubleshoot test anomalies, equipment issues, and environmental system failures to minimize downtime and improve repeatability
Manage lab equipment health, including preventative maintenance, calibration tracking, repair scheduling, upgrade scoping, and documentation
Maintain lab organization and safety standards, including ESD controls, tool/equipment upkeep, and consumables tracking
Train and mentor technicians and engineers in test procedures, equipment operation, lab safety, and environmental test best practices
Collaborate with product, design, and quality engineering teams to resolve issues, improve test methods, and ensure successful hardware test campaigns
Author and conduct training modules covering environmental equipment use, environmental test methodology, and lab safety protocols
